St. Louis Cardinals Logo Evolution: History & Symbolism (YouTube History)

The St Louis Cardinals logo has become one of the most recognizable symbols in all of sports, blending classic red, white, and blue with a bold bird and bat. For YouTube viewers and brand historians alike, the evolution of this mark tells a story of continuity, civic pride, and meticulous design choices.

Across more than a century, the Cardinals icon has shifted from simple typography to a polished emblem, reflecting both baseball tradition and modern marketing. This overview highlights the symbol history and key design shifts that keep the mark instantly identifiable on every broadcast.

Cardinals Primary Logo Symbol History

The earliest Cardinals marks leaned heavily on the team name, using block letters that emphasized readability over illustration. As visual branding matured, the organization introduced a stylized bird perched over a bat, creating an icon that could stand alone on caps and jerseys.

Over subsequent decades, refinements to line weight, negative space, and color balance turned that bird into a streamlined silhouette. Each adjustment aimed to improve legibility on television, in print, and on merchandise, ensuring the symbol remained powerful even as production techniques evolved.

Design Evolution Across Decades

Examining decade by decade reveals how the Cardinals logo adapted to graphic trends while preserving its core identity. The 1930s bird was more realistic, with textured feathers and detailed wings, whereas later versions favored bolder outlines and simplified forms.

By the late twentieth century, tighter spacing and sharper curves allowed the shape to perform at small sizes on televised games and large formats on stadium signage. These updates kept the mark competitive with other league brands that were modernizing their own visual languages.

Typography and Color Choices in the Mark

Type selection has played a crucial role in the Cardinals logo history, especially for wordmark treatments used across official communications. The current logotype combines a sturdy sans with subtle tapering, giving a forward-leaning sense of motion that aligns with the bird in flight.

Color strategy reinforces this energy, with bright red drawing attention on white backgrounds and navy or blue accents adding depth. Consistent use of these hues across the logo system strengthens instant recognition for fans in St Louis and around the world.
